
PETALING JAYA: Malaysian women’s squash champion S Sivasangari has qualified for the quarter-finals of the World Championships in Giza, Egypt, after beating Belgium’s Tinne Gilis in straight games today.
Sivasangari, the tournament’s fifth seed, won 11-5, 13-11, 11-3 against Gilis, who was seeded ninth.
It was the Malaysian’s third victory in four encounters over her opponent, after having beaten her at the Cincinnati Gaynor Cup in 2022 and the Grasshopper Cup in 2025.
Sivasangari is in good form following her victory in the 2026 Grasshopper Cup in Zurich, Switzerland, two weeks ago when she beat Japan’s Satomi Watanabe 15-13, 5-11, 5-11, 11-7, 11-8 in a 62-minute final.
